Title Specific Tasks:
Administer, configure, and maintain OpenText Content Server (Livelink) environments.
Manage system performance, availability, and reliability, including monitoring and troubleshooting.
Implement and support Electronic Document Management (EDM) processes including document capture, storage, retrieval, and archival.
Design and manage user roles, permissions, and security models to ensure compliance with organizational policies.
Perform system upgrades, patches, and migrations as required.
Develop and maintain workflows, forms, and business process automations within OpenText.
Collaborate with business stakeholders to gather requirements and implement content management solutions.
Ensure compliance with records management, retention, and regulatory requirements.
Support integrations between OpenText and other enterprise systems (e.g., ERP, Custom .Net applications).
Create and maintain system documentation, SOPs, and user training materials.
